Problem framing

Lab tests and imaging exams are a core part of clinical diagnosis, yet in Brazil results often reach physicians in lengthy, fragmented, non-standardized formats that require manual review, data extraction, and documentation in electronic health records (EHRs).

The inefficient workflow disrupts clinical care, reduces physician–patient interaction during appointments, and shifts work to unpaid hours, increasing time spent on administrative tasks instead of patient care.

Interviewed Radiologist

[...] it’s always a moment in the consultation when, in theory, you need to be focused because you’re analyzing the exams. But it creates an awkward situation where the patient is waiting. There’s silence and anxiety, because they want to know the results, and you’re looking at the exams instead of focusing on them.

Interviewed Geriatrician

During the appointment, they bring everything printed. So I take pictures and write things down later, otherwise I lose too much time.

Hypothesis

By summarizing diagnostic test results with AI, physicians spend less time on documentation, enabling more attentive, patient-centered care.

Build Process

After defining the high-fidelity designs in Figma and building automations in n8n, I moved into the implementation phase, developing the platform on Lovable. Named Turi Saúde Lab, the platform hosts multiple tools for rapid validation while maintaining a flexible architecture for iteration.

The first tool, Clinical Exam Summarizer, focused on structuring multi-page PDFs into synthesized, ready-to-use clinical annotations with one click.

Initial Launch

After two months of development, I launched the tool to validate the core hypothesis and generate company leads. Users can upload up to three PDF files, which are summarized by AI into concise, factual outputs. With one click, multi-page files are ready to copy and paste into EHRs, reducing manual steps and enabling faster analysis.

Supporting More Files and Image Formats

User surveys indicated strong adoption, reflected in an NPS of 9.25, and highlighted physicians’ need to process more files, including image-based inputs. In response, I increased upload limits and enabled simultaneous processing of PDF and PNG/JPEG files.

Improving OCR Accuracy and Summary Consistency

User feedback revealed incomplete clinical summaries. After testing and desk research, I replaced the OCR tool and refined the AI system prompt, improving extraction accuracy and summary consistency.

Highlighting Abnormalities for Actionable Insights

Physicians’ needs varied by specialty and documentation preferences. To keep outputs actionable, I added a dedicated section highlighting clinical abnormalities.

Freemium Model

Improving OCR accuracy raised per-page costs by 11×, materially impacting unit economics. After validating user interest, Turi Saúde Lab transitioned to a freemium model—capped free usage with unlimited paid plans—to better align revenue with operating costs.

Key Learnings and Tradeoffs

  • Managing two products in one squad required strong prioritization and systems thinking.

  • Choosing vibe-coding over a traditional development process reduced dependency and opportunity cost.

  • Prioritizing accuracy over cost ensured output quality—critical in healthcare.
